The FET 2024 registration is ongoing from December 27, 2024, to January 16, 2025. The exam will be held on February 23, 2025, with the admit card releasing on February 19, 2025.
The registration process for the National Eligibility Entrance Test for Foreign Medical Graduates (NEET FET) 2025 has begun. The last date for registration is January 16, 2025. Note that the FET exam date 2025 has been revised to February 23, 2025. Aspiring candidates must follow a systematic approach to complete their application process through the official portal of the National Board of Examinations in Medical Sciences (NBEMS). The NEET FET 2025 is an essential exam for foreign medical graduates wishing to practice medicine in India.

NEET FET 2025 Exam Dates & Schedule
| Dates | Events |
|---|---|
| 27 Dec '24 - 16 Jan '25 | FET 2025 Registration |
| 20 Jan '25 - 22 Jan '25 | FET 2025 Edit Window |
| 31 Jan '25 - 03 Feb '25 | FET 2025 Final Edit Window |
| 19 Feb '25 | FET 2025 Admit Card |
| 23 Feb '25 | FET 2025 Exam Date |
| 21 Mar '25 | FET 2025 Result Declaration |
NEET FET 2025 Application Process
After completing the registration, candidates need to follow the below steps to submit their application for the NEET FET 2025 exam:
| Step | Details |
|---|---|
| Step 1: Open the Application Form | Candidates log in with the provided credentials and access the application form. A new login can be done using the ‘Applicant Login’ option on the NBEMS portal. |
| Step 2: Fill in the Application Form | Enter personal, educational, and other required details correctly in the application form. |
| Step 3: Upload Documents | Upload the photograph, signature, and thumb impression in the required format and size. |
| Step 4: Select Test City | Choose a preferred test city where you wish to appear for the exam. Note that centers are allotted on a first-come, first-served basis. |
| Step 5: Payment of Application Fee | Pay the application fee through the NBEMS payment gateway. Without payment, the application will not be accepted. |
| Step 6: Review and Submit | After filling the form, review all the details and submit the application. Print a copy of the completed form and payment receipt. |
Required Documents for Upload
Candidates need to upload the following documents in the specified format:
| Document Type | Format | Dimensions | Size Limit |
|---|---|---|---|
| Photograph | JPEG | Height: 1¼ inch, Width: 1 3/8 inch | Less than 80 KB |
| Signature | JPEG | Height: 1.5 cm, Width: 3.5 cm | Less than 80 KB |
| Thumb Impression | JPEG | Height: 1.5 cm, Width: 3.5 cm | Less than 80 KB |
Application Fee
Candidates must pay the application fee after completing their registration. The fee details are as follows:
| Category | Fees (INR) |
|---|---|
| Indian Students | 4,250 |
| International Students | 44,250 (37,500 + 18% GST) |
Final Submission
Once all the details have been entered and the application fee is paid, candidates must review their application. After confirming the information, they can submit the application form. A successful submission will be marked with an 'S,' while failure to complete the payment will show an 'F'. After submission, candidates should take a printout of the application form and payment receipt for future reference.
